Transaction 4374ba30911530a20758cf27875c024839edefdb5aafc84a810c11fae6ea3086
1 Input
1 Output
-
4374ba30911530a20758cf27875c024839edefdb5aafc84a810c11fae6ea3086:0
- value
- 95582
- script pubkey
- OP_0 OP_PUSHBYTES_20 95fa2405d69432ff811306c51f9aaa1e2afddc54
- address
- bc1qjhazgpwkjse0lqgnqmz3lx42rc40mhz5yv3e4m